LA9 4RU is a non-residential postcode in Kendal, Cumbria. It was first introduced in January 1980.
The most common council tax bands are and .
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£91,200 to £3,819,321 with an average of £797,424.
Commercial rateable values range from £2,000 to £31,000 with an average of £9,989. The most common recorded business types are Warehouse and Workshop.
Kendal is a town, which had a population of 28,586 in the 2011 census.
LA9 4RU is in the Kendal trav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Cumbria Teaching Primary Care Trust.
LA9 4RU is approximately 50m (164ft) above sea level.
